پاسخ: مباحث برنامه نویسی موبایل تحت چارچوب دات نت
با سلام!
نقل قول:
بهتره این برنامه هارو روی دستگاه PDA هم تست بشه که به عینه ببینیم برنامه رو ( متاسفانه ما که PDA یا موبایلی که Windows رو پشتیبانی کنه نداریم :دی )
بنده هم با این عمل موافقم. اکثر سورس هایی که این جا می ذارم به طور واقعی روی پاکت پی سی اجرا شده به جز اونایی که نسخه ی ناپایدارند.:1. (26):
ـــــــــــــــــــــــــ ــــــــــ
در این جا چند نکته ای از کلاس گرافیک می گم...!چون این تاپیک با استقبال مواجه نشده، من به شخصه سورس پایه نمی ذارم و سورس ها رو همه رو کاربردی قرار می دم.:1. (28):
کلاس گرافیک در WinCE:
در این کلاس با محدودیت های زیادی مواجه هستیم. بخش Render از خاصیت High Quality پشتیبانی نمی کنه و ترسیم به حالت عادی صورت می گیره.
برای استفاده از برس ها باید به سراغ SolidBrush برید.
خوشبختانه متد های Drawing به طور کامل در دسترس هستند.
موارد مربوط به عمق رنگ هم هیچ تفاوت چندانی نداره.
در پست های آینده یه کامپوننت قرار نی دم که موارد بالا رو واضح نشون بده.:wink:
شاد باشید
آرمین:11():
پاسخ: مباحث برنامه نویسی موبایل تحت چارچوب دات نت
سلام
ممنون استاد آرمین از آموزش هاتون
ولی به آموزش xamarin اشاره ای میشد ، خیلی خوب بود (هر چند در زمان شروع تاپیک ، زامارین وجود نداشت)
من یه سئوال درباره ی زامارین هم داشتم . اینکه خیلی ها و خود گوگل میگه از جاوا و android studio برای برنامه نویسی اندروید استفاده کنید
ولی چه فرقی دارن؟ مهمترین چیزش که sdk شه که اگه اشتباه نکنم ، دقیق همون sdk ای که در android studio برای اندروید هست ، همون هم برای زامارین هم تعبیه شده .
زبان سی شارپ هم که کم از زبان جاوا نداره . پس تفاوت شون چیه؟!
پاسخ: مباحث برنامه نویسی موبایل تحت چارچوب دات نت
نقل قول:
...
من یه سئوال درباره ی زامارین هم داشتم . اینکه خیلی ها و خود گوگل میگه از جاوا و android studio برای برنامه نویسی اندروید استفاده کنید
ولی چه فرقی دارن؟ مهمترین چیزش که sdk شه که اگه اشتباه نکنم ، دقیق همون sdk ای که در android studio برای اندروید هست ، همون هم برای زامارین هم تعبیه شده .
زبان سی شارپ هم که کم از زبان جاوا نداره . پس تفاوت شون چیه؟!
سلام،
سجاد جان منظورت رو از SDK متوجه نمیشم!
اندروید شامل دسته ای از Native API ها هستش که در Android Studio به شکل مستقیم بهشون دسترسی داریم. ولی در Xamarin به واسه ی Mono میشه از Native API ها بهره برد. در نتیجه برنامه ی ساخته شده با Xamarin کند تر از Android Studio عمل میکنه. اما در مقابل Cross-platform هستش و میشه همون برنامه رو برای iOS یا ویندوز هم کامپایل کرد بدون اینکه نیازی به تغییر سورس کد باشه.
تفاوت بالا یک فرق بنیادی بین این دو محسوب میشه. ولی استفاده از هر کدوم بیش تر سلیقه ای...
اطلاعات بیش تر:
برای مشاهده این لینک/عکس می بایست عضو شوید !برای عضویت اینجا کلیک کنید ]
برای مشاهده این لینک/عکس می بایست عضو شوید !برای عضویت اینجا کلیک کنید ]
پاسخ: مباحث برنامه نویسی موبایل تحت چارچوب دات نت
نقل قول:
سلام،
سجاد جان منظورت رو از SDK متوجه نمیشم!
اندروید شامل دسته ای از Native API ها هستش که در Android Studio به شکل مستقیم بهشون دسترسی داریم. ولی در Xamarin به واسه ی Mono میشه از Native API ها بهره برد. در نتیجه برنامه ی ساخته شده با Xamarin کند تر از Android Studio عمل میکنه. اما در مقابل Cross-platform هستش و میشه همون برنامه رو برای iOS یا ویندوز هم کامپایل کرد بدون اینکه نیازی به تغییر سورس کد باشه.
تفاوت بالا یک فرق بنیادی بین این دو محسوب میشه. ولی استفاده از هر کدوم بیش تر سلیقه ای...
اطلاعات بیش تر:
برای مشاهده این لینک/عکس می بایست عضو شوید !برای عضویت اینجا کلیک کنید ]
برای مشاهده این لینک/عکس می بایست عضو شوید !برای عضویت اینجا کلیک کنید ]
سلام
آها ممنون استاد آرمین
یعنی در قدرت برنامه نویسی ، بین پروژه های زامارین و اندروید استودیو فرقی وجود نداره؟
یعنی هر برنامه ای که توی اندروید استودیو بشه نوشت را توی زامارین هم میشه نوشت؟
پاسخ: مباحث برنامه نویسی موبایل تحت چارچوب دات نت
نقل قول:
سلام
آها ممنون استاد آرمین
یعنی در قدرت برنامه نویسی ، بین پروژه های زامارین و اندروید استودیو فرقی وجود نداره؟
یعنی هر برنامه ای که توی اندروید استودیو بشه نوشت را توی زامارین هم میشه نوشت؟
بی شک تو سطح Native دست ما باز تره. اما در Xamarin اکثر قریب به اتفاق توابع Native پوشش داده شده.
با این حال چون بنده تجربه ی چندانی در مورد این دو ندارم، نمی تونم با صراحت بگم که هر برنامه ای که توی اندروید استودیو بشه نوشت را توی زامارین هم میشه نوشت!